How to Use Elementor’s Global Colors & Fonts

Elementor’s Global Colors and Fonts are a great way to quickly style your website. With just a few clicks, you can easily change the colors and fonts of all your webpages. Here’s how you can use Elementor’s Global Colors & Fonts:

1. Open up the Elementor editor in WordPress and click on the ‘Global Colors’ or ‘Global Fonts’ section.

2. Select a color from the Global Color Palette or a font from the Global Fonts list.

3. Once you have selected a color or font, it will be applied to all elements on your page.

4. To make further changes, simply select another color or font from the list.

Elementor’s Global Colors and Fonts makes it easy to apply uniform styling across your entire website.

All you need to do is pick the colors and fonts that you like, and Elementor will take care of the rest.

Changing the Colors

To change the colors of your website using Global Colors, go to Elementor > Settings > Style > Colors.

This will open the Global Colors panel, where you can change the colors of your website’s header, body, and Accent colors.

To change a color, click on the color swatch and select a new color from the color picker. You can also enter a Hex code or RGB value directly.

Once you’ve selected a new color, hit the Save button to apply your changes.
